Subject: [Openstack] [keystone] publicurl vs adminurl reachability


More to the point: It's unclear to me whether adminurl endpoints are designed 
such that they may be restricted to private networks, or if they are expected 
to be as reachable as publicurl endpoints are. 
[Kaustubh] I haven't tried this out, but this seems to be supported. 
(http://docs.openstack.org/mitaka/install-guide-ubuntu/keystone-services.html#id1),
 point 2:
"In a production environment, the variants might reside on separate networks 
that service different types of users for security reasons". It does makes 
sense to isolate at least the public API (read customer traffic )network from 
the admin and internal API endpoints.
